How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Beechview?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Beechview Studio Apartments | $1,539 | $900 | $4,500 |
| Beechview 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,624 | $750 | $6,255 |
| Beechview 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,829 | $880 | $5,682 |
| Beechview 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,085 | $1,050 | $5,802 |
| Beechview 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,600 | $1,600 | $1,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Beechview Apartments with Laundry Rooms
What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Beechview?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Beechview with Laundry Rooms is at Hoodridge Manor Apartments listed at $750.
How much is the average rent for Beechview Apartments with Laundry Rooms?
The average rent for a Apartment in Beechview with Laundry Rooms is $1,472.
What is the largest Beechview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?
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Beechview is a 1,500 square feet unit starting from $1,030 at Hyland Hills.
What is the average size for Beechview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?
The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in Beechview is currently at 714 sq ft.
